Aesop Fabulous Face Cleanser 6.7oz
Overview
The Aesop Fabulous Face Cleanser 6.7oz comes from a brand that has built its reputation on botanical formulas stripped of unnecessary fillers — and this olive-based formula reflects that philosophy clearly. Where most drugstore washes lean on harsh sulfates, it takes a quieter approach: a gentle lather that barely foams, a scent built around bergamot, chamomile, and rosemary that lingers just long enough to make the routine feel intentional. The texture is light and almost milky before it rinses. It is designed primarily for normal and combination skin types, though dry-skin users often reach for it during warmer months when their skin needs less heavy intervention.
Features & Benefits
The cleansing base is derived from olive, which means it works with the skin rather than against it — you finish rinsing and your face feels clean without that familiar tight, stripped sensation. Bergamot rind brings brightness to the scent alongside subtle purifying properties, while chamomile bud extract quietly addresses redness, making this a reasonable daily option even for skin that runs reactive. Rosemary leaf rounds out the botanical trio with antioxidant support. The formula is fully vegan and cruelty-free. At 6.7oz, a twice-daily routine stretches the bottle further than you might expect for a product at this price tier.
Best For
This botanical cleanser suits people who want a wash that cleans without drama — no foam rush, no tight post-rinse feeling, just skin that feels calm and balanced. It is an especially good fit for those with normal or combination skin who have already built out a solid routine and need a cleanser that stays out of the way. Dry-skin types may find it works well in spring and summer but lean toward something richer when temperatures drop. If you care about ingredient sourcing, fragrance experience, and a bottle that looks at home on a minimal shelf, the Aesop face wash delivers on all three. Oily skin types needing a deep cleanse will likely want something stronger.

Specifications
- Volume: Each bottle contains 6.7 oz (200ml) of cleanser, enough for approximately 2 to 3 months of twice-daily use.
- Cleansing Base: The formula uses an olive-derived surfactant system designed to remove impurities without disrupting the skin's natural moisture barrier.
- Key Botanicals: Active botanical ingredients include bergamot rind, chamomile bud extract, and rosemary leaf, each selected for purifying, calming, or antioxidant properties.
- Scent Profile: The natural fragrance is an herbal-citrus blend of bergamot, chamomile, and rosemary that fades shortly after rinsing.
- Skin Types: Formulated for normal and combination skin year-round, and suitable for dry skin during warmer seasons when a lighter cleanse is appropriate.
- Skin Feel: Post-rinse skin feels refreshed, calm, and gently cleansed without tightness, dryness, or residue.
- Application: Lather a small amount in clean hands, massage over face and neck, and rinse thoroughly with warm water morning and evening.
- Vegan Status: The formula contains no animal-derived ingredients and is certified vegan by Aesop's product standards.
- Cruelty-Free: This product is cruelty-free, meaning no animal testing is conducted on the formula or its individual ingredients.
- Manufacturer: Produced by Aesop, an Australian premium skincare brand known for botanically-driven, minimalist formulations.
- Item Weight: The filled bottle weighs approximately 8.11 oz (230g), making it suitable for counter storage but borderline for carry-on liquid limits when traveling.
- Dimensions: The bottle measures 1.97 x 1.97 x 5.51 inches, with a slim, upright silhouette designed for minimal bathroom shelving.
- Texture: The cleanser has a light, semi-milky texture that produces minimal lather — intentional to the olive-derived formula design.
